UKGC Licensing: Why It Matters More Than Ever

I cannot stress this enough. You must play at UKGC licensed casinos. The UK Gambling Commission is tough. They enforce strict rules on fairness, deposit limits, and self-exclusion. If a casino holds a UKGC license, you know the games are tested for RNG (Random Number Generator) fairness. You know your money is safe. And you know they have to follow responsible gambling protocols.

Why I Still Recommend a Good Old-Fashioned Slot

You might think I am crazy for recommending a 2014 slot game in 2026. But hear me out. Jackpot 6000 is the perfect game for no deposit spins. Why? Because of the supermeter mode. You collect wins in the base game to build up your supermeter balance. Then, you can gamble those credits at higher stakes for a shot at the 6000 coin jackpot. It is a risk-reward mechanic that fits perfectly with the ‘free’ nature of the bonus. You are not burning through your bonus cash on random spins. You are building a war chest.

Plus, it is incredibly fair. The RTP is 98.9% when playing optimally in the supermeter mode. That is among the highest of any slot. So, if you get a no deposit offer that allows you to play Jackpot 6000, you are in a very strong position.
